What you'll see and do
Osaka Castle
You will learn the following at Osaka Castle: ・The construction of Japanese castles; ・The life of Hideyoshi Toyotomi, one of the renounced samurai-daimyos in the 16th century
45 minutes here · Admission not included
This place is one of the busiest areas in Osaka. You can enjoy shopping or eating Japanese traditional dish such as sushi and "Okonomiyaki (savory local pizza)."
90 minutes here
Kuromon Market
After lunch, you will visit Kuromon Ichiba Market.
50 minutes here
Sumiyoshi Shrine
You will learn the following at this shrine: ・The difference between Shinto and Buddhism; ・The meanings of a Torii gate; ・How to properly pray at a shrine.
30 minutes here
Where it starts and ends
Meeting point
Osaka
Meeting Point: In front of Lawson Osaka Castle Park Rest House (near Otemon Gate). Take Osaka Metro Tanimachi Line to Tanimachi 4-chome Station (Exit 9). Walk straight toward NHK Osaka, cross the street, and enter through Otemon Gate. Lawson is on the left. Look for our guide holding a sign.
Hotel pickup
Pickup is available for selected locations. Pickup begins about 30 minutes before departure.
Ends at
The final stop is Sumiyoshi Taisha where we will disband.

How many days do you need in Osaka?
+
Three full days covers the headline sights without sprinting. A workable rhythm is one anchor experience each morning, such as this one, an unhurried afternoon in a single neighborhood, then a food or nightlife booking in the evening. Five days lets you add a day trip outside the city.
